Weight Loss Reduces Cancer Risk
A new study reports weight loss with bariatric surgery reduces cancer risk. But can we achieve similar results without surgery? A new medication tirzepatide shows similar weight loss to surgery with more than 20 kilos lost. But what about lifestyle? Virta Health reported their 5-year data that isn’t as impressive as surgery or medications, but is still significant at almost 9 kilos and without the side effects. Let’s see if we can make sense of all the different data!
